My screen name was bestowed upon me by a hunting buddy - but during a fishing trip. He had invited me to go trout fishing in the North Georgia mountains several times but I kept declining the invitation, due to my extremely limited experience with fishing of any kind. I finally agreed to go and my buddy "assigned me" to his brother - who set about trying to teach me how to tie a knot, cast properly and land the slippery trout if I hooked one. Our first day out, I found several "hot spots" where the trout were really biting - but every time I caught one, the line would snag, the hook would come off the line or some other calamity would befall me. I would get disgusted and move to the next hole and repeat the process. In the meantime, my new "coach" would follow behind me and invariably land a nice trout in the very holes I had found during my futile effort to catch fish. When he returned to camp that evening, my "coach" started call me "Bird Dog" - since I had "sniffed out" most of the great holes he caught his limit from that day. The nickname stuck - as did my desire to keep fishing. I'm the prize student of my old "coach", now - having become a very good trout fisherman and loving that annual trip to North Georgia.

Real name is John, but my parents always called me "Jack" after JFK.
Kinda stumbled upon my first hang where I had backpacked in with the intention of tent camping. Also, the event was in late December and this would be my first trip in cold temps. Love the outdoors but don't like being cold so I packed three bags, one fleece, one 3-season down, and one sub-zero artificial. I mentioned the 3 bags to one of the other campers and from then on I was known as:
Jackie 3 bags
